This image was taken for a story that ran in The Manawatu Evening Standard on 03 August 1981, with the caption: "On the verge of the unknown…the thin blue line faces the protesters.” The Standard reported that protesters against the Springbok Rugby Tour game held against Manawatū on 1 August, stood ‘eyeball to eyeball’ with Police in riot gear for 24 minutes during an unplanned standoff on the intersection of David and Cuba Streets.
